    Don Julio Celebrates Nollywood Stars at 12th AMVCA

    Premium tequila brand, Don Julio, took centre stage at the 12th edition of the Africa Magic Viewers’ Choice Awards as the headline sponsor, using the platform to celebrate excellence, creativity and craftsmanship in African film and television.

    Held in Lagos, the AMVCA brought together some of the continent’s biggest stars, filmmakers and entertainment personalities, with Don Julio introducing “The Don’s Table,” a symbolic experience designed to honour individuals whose dedication and years of commitment have shaped their careers.

    A statement shared with Saturday Beats noted that the initiative, which was inspired by the legacy of Don Julio González, celebrated professionals whose consistency and devotion to their craft have earned them defining moments of recognition.

    As part of its involvement, the brand sponsored three major award categories— Best Actor, Best Supporting Actress and Best Film of the Year.

    Hosted by media personality, Uti Nwachukwu, The Don’s Table became one of the highlights of the evening, providing an intimate space where winners reflected on their creative journeys and the discipline behind their success.

    Actor Uzor Arukwe emerged as the recipient of the Best Actor recognition, earning applause from guests who described the honour as long overdue.

    For Best Supporting Actress, Linda Ejiofor-Suleiman was celebrated for her versatility, resilience and ability to bring authenticity to her roles.

    The Best Film of the Year recognition went to ‘My Father’s Shadow’, with filmmakers, Funmbi Ogunbawo and Wale Davis, honoured for a project many described as reflective of the growing global appeal of African storytelling.

    To commemorate the moment, each winner received an engraved bottle of Don Julio 1942, a gesture the brand said symbolised permanence, recognition and earned excellence.

    One of the memorable moments of the night came during the Don Julio 1942 toast, led by comedian and host Bovi Ugboma, who celebrated the achievements of creatives shaping the future of African entertainment.

    Don Julio also made an impression on the AMVCA red carpet through its Fashion Icon of the Night, Uche Montana, who appeared in a custom outfit designed by Tubo founder, Tubo Bereni. Inspired by the rise of a phoenix, the outfit symbolised reinvention, strength and ambition.
